visas or participate in STEM OPT for this position. Job Description
Coaches, mentors and leads tellers by example to deliver a unique
customer experience aimed at improving customer financial wellbeing
and creating loyalty while increasing share of wallet. Processes a
variety of customer interactions. Educates customers on
alternatives available for their financial interactions. Identifies
banking opportunities during the customer interaction and refers as
appropriate. Coaches, mentors and leads tellers by example in
identifying opportunities through meaningful conversations with
customers, making appropriate referrals to branch staff. Coaches,
mentors and leads tellers by example in performing lobby engagement
activities to connect with customers and position PNC products to
meet their needs. Educates customers on options for managing
financial transactions by leveraging technology, tools and
resources. Coaches, mentors and leads tellers by example with clear
communication skills, transaction handling and problem resolution
processes. Assists the Branch Manager in performance management and
new hire selection processes. Coaches, mentors and leads tellers by
example in adhering to all policies and procedures, demonstrating
sound judgment within established limits. Ensures teller and branch
daily operations and maintenance transactions are completed in an
efficient and accurate manner. PNC Employees take pride in our
